Drivetrain

Forged Sprockets & Chain Wheels

Sprocket teeth take impact loading every time a chain roller seats. Forged blanks give the dense, uniform structure that survives that hammering once hardened — cast sprockets chip at the tooth tip long before a forged one shows measurable wear.

Impact at Every Tooth Engagement

Chain drives load teeth suddenly rather than smoothly. Surface hardness resists wear, but the tough forged core is what stops a hardened tooth from snapping off under shock — a balance a fully hardened cast tooth cannot strike.

  • Hardened tooth flanks
  • Tough forged core
  • No porosity at tooth tips
  • Uniform pitch accuracy
02

Pitch and Profile Accuracy

Tooth profile and pitch circle are machined to the chain standard so load distributes across several teeth instead of concentrating on one. Bore, keyway and hub faces are finished in the same setup family to keep the sprocket running true.

03

Duty-Matched Materials

EN8 and SAE 1045 for general conveyor duty; EN19 and 42CrMo4 with induction hardened flanks for agricultural and crawler applications that see abrasive, shock-loaded service.
